When to Use Dealer Finance
Going to dealership and finding your vehicle on your own is okay if you want to pay a bit more. Dealers like to add what is called “back-end” products that will often inflate the cost of the vehicle. Make sure you read the fine print if you choose Dealer financing. Dealers will often shop your deal around to different lenders and let you take the vehicle home. Sometimes they can’t get financing with bad credit and they ask that you bring the vehicle back. Dealers will most always ask for a down payment for the vehicle.
Budget for your Bad Credit Auto Loan
When considering a bad credit auto loan make sure you budget an affordable amount. A brand new luxury car sounds great and all, but the payment could wipe you out. A general rule of thumb is to budget no more than 15% of your monthly take home pay and remember to budget your car insurance payment as well. Also, take into consideration the costs of operating your vehicle. Try to budget gas, maintenance, and the unexpected costs of repair.

What to expect when applying for a Bad Credit Auto Loan
Your rate is going to be higher than someone with good credit. The lender may ask you for pay stubs, personal and professional references, bank statements and other supporting documentation. Don’t worry this is normal and by providing these items in a timely manner your funding process could be quick. Remember, the lender is willing to lend you money for the vehicle and they need to ensure that you have the ability and intent to pay it back. Most want to lend you money, so cooperation and accurate information is necessitated.
